Bangladesh's Prime Minister is taking a step towards a greener future, putting the country's locally made electric vehicles to the test. In a move aimed at boosting the domestic automotive industry, the Prime Minister recently took the wheel of several electric vehicles manufactured in the country. This high-profile endorsement comes as the government looks to provide support to local manufacturers in the face of increasing competition from foreign imports. With the government's backing, industry insiders are hoping to see a surge in the production and adoption of eco-friendly vehicles, potentially transforming the country's transportation landscape.
